Trait tract_core::internal::tract_ndarray::DataOwned [−][src]
pub unsafe trait DataOwned: Data { type MaybeUninit: DataOwned + RawDataSubst<Self::Elem>; }
Expand description
Array representation trait.
A representation that is a unique or shared owner of its data.
Internal trait, see Data.
Associated Types
type MaybeUninit: DataOwned + RawDataSubst<Self::Elem>[src]
type MaybeUninit: DataOwned + RawDataSubst<Self::Elem>[src]Corresponding owned data with MaybeUninit elements
Implementors
impl<A> DataOwned for OwnedArcRepr<A>[src]
impl<A> DataOwned for OwnedArcRepr<A>[src]type MaybeUninit = OwnedArcRepr<MaybeUninit<A>>
pub fn new(elements: Vec<A, Global>) -> OwnedArcRepr<A>[src]
pub fn into_shared(self) -> OwnedArcRepr<A>[src]
impl<A> DataOwned for OwnedRepr<A>[src]
impl<A> DataOwned for OwnedRepr<A>[src]